Recognize -sysv* after -sysvr4.
authorRichard Stallman <rms@gnu.org>
Tue, 29 Jun 1993 15:31:19 +0000 (15:31 +0000)
committerRichard Stallman <rms@gnu.org>
Tue, 29 Jun 1993 15:31:19 +0000 (15:31 +0000)
config.sub
lib/config.sub

index f4a5213..6fd3fe5 100644 (file)
@@ -501,7 +501,8 @@ case $os in
        # First accept the basic system types.
        # The portable systems comes first.
        # Each alternative must end in a *, to match a version number.
-       -bsd* | -sysv* | -mach* | -minix* | -genix* | -ultrix* | -irix* \
+       # -sysv* is not here because it comes later, after sysvr4.
+       -bsd* | -mach* | -minix* | -genix* | -ultrix* | -irix* \
              | -vms* | -sco* | -esix* | -isc* | -aix* | -sunos | -sunos[34]* | -hpux* \
              | -unos* | -osf* | -luna* | -dgux* | -solaris* | -sym* \
              | -amigados* | -msdos* | -newsos* | -unicos* | -aos* \
@@ -542,11 +543,14 @@ case $os in
        -svr4)
                os=-sysv4
                ;;
+       -svr3)
+               os=-sysv3
+               ;;
        -sysvr4)
                os=-sysv4
                ;;
-       -svr3)
-               os=-sysv3
+       # This must come after -sysvr4.
+       -sysv*)
                ;;
        -xenix)
                os=-xenix
index f4a5213..6fd3fe5 100644 (file)
@@ -501,7 +501,8 @@ case $os in
        # First accept the basic system types.
        # The portable systems comes first.
        # Each alternative must end in a *, to match a version number.
-       -bsd* | -sysv* | -mach* | -minix* | -genix* | -ultrix* | -irix* \
+       # -sysv* is not here because it comes later, after sysvr4.
+       -bsd* | -mach* | -minix* | -genix* | -ultrix* | -irix* \
              | -vms* | -sco* | -esix* | -isc* | -aix* | -sunos | -sunos[34]* | -hpux* \
              | -unos* | -osf* | -luna* | -dgux* | -solaris* | -sym* \
              | -amigados* | -msdos* | -newsos* | -unicos* | -aos* \
@@ -542,11 +543,14 @@ case $os in
        -svr4)
                os=-sysv4
                ;;
+       -svr3)
+               os=-sysv3
+               ;;
        -sysvr4)
                os=-sysv4
                ;;
-       -svr3)
-               os=-sysv3
+       # This must come after -sysvr4.
+       -sysv*)
                ;;
        -xenix)
                os=-xenix